In my case there seems to be a discrepancy > between the way the webbrowser control works versus loading a page > directly in the IE window. I believe the problem is related to XP > SP2 and the Internet Explorer Local Machine Zone Lockdown (see > http://www.microsoft.com/technet/prodtechnol/winxppro/maintain/sp2brow > s.mspx). > > I have tried various tricks like using the "Mark of the Web" (<!-- > saved from url=(0013)about:internet -->), inline script that > references external javascript funtions that build the embed tag, all > with no success. > > The webbrowser control is supposed to be a wrapper on IE so my guess > is that something in my .net security settings is not right. I have > granted full trust to my .net app so I don't know what else I could > do. > > Simon > > > > --- In [email protected], "Samuel Dagan" <dagan@> > wrote: > > > > Hi Simon, > > I don't have any magic solutions, but I'll tell you what I know. > The > > number of messages that I am mentioning are from the Yahoo > > svg-developers group. > > > > If you have installed IE7 on top of the previous IE6, you can just > > uninstall IE7, then the IE6 takes over, which solves your problems. > > This is written at the MS site, I've try it, and it works.
